"I have been doing this role for about 6 years now, I am also on a National committee (VPEG) to help guide BHS volunteering policy. I owned my first horse at 53 before that I had ridden other people's in many parts of the country and I could not believe how few places to go for a decent ride that there were off the yard where I kept my horse. I therefore decided that I would try to open up more places to ride. (This is also a safety issue - to help keep riders on safe places to ride, rather than busy roads) This is a slow and difficult process - I see myself more as a PR person rather than one that can pore over ancient documents, to find forgotten rights of way!
I believe that all off-road rights of way should be open to all non-motorised traffic and to achieve this we ought to be universally on-side with walkers and cyclists. I have always loved horses and my best friend at junior school had ponies so I rode hers - I went on the volunteering at a riding school for free rides and have ridden other people's till I got my own 14 years ago. He is an ex-racer and we still plod around together even though we have a joint age of over 90!
Horses in three words: For the Feeling sums it up perfectly!"
